Add shredded coconut and panko to a blender and blend for 30 seconds (this mixes the panko and coconut and also shreds the coconut more) Drop a small amount of breaded mixture in heated oil. If it sizzles it is ready. Add fish to heated oil and fry until golden brown (flip halfway through) Enjoy the easiest and tastiest coconut-crusted Mahi EVER!
